2) They would not kill you, but you won't sell one single cup in centuries. We don't like that black water you call coffee, and you can probably find it only in a dozen of place around Italy. But don't worry, once you get used to the strong taste of Italian coffee you won't be able to do without.
3) The hours can vary alot dipending on month and place. Generally bars open around 7AM and close around 8PM, and in big cities they don't do the lunch pause.
